How does the order of choices affect consumer decisions?

Thursday, March 15, 2012 - 10:01 in Mathematics & Economics

Let's say you've got to book a flight, choose a hotel, and rent a car. Does it matter which thing you shop for first? A new study in the Journal of Consumer Research finds that the order of choices does affect consumers' decisions.
